KEA PGCET Results 2022

On 24th December 2022, Saturday, the Karnataka Examinations Authority (KEA) announced the result-releasing date for the Karnataka Post Graduate Common Entrance Test (PGCET) 2022. The KEA PGCET Results 2022 are scheduled to be announced on 29th December 2022 after 04:00 PM. All the aspirants who participated in the Karnataka Post Graduate Common Entrance Test (PGCET) 2022 can check their report cards on the official Karnataka Examinations Authority (KEA) webpage. The Karnataka Examinations Authority (KEA) organized the Post Graduate Common Entrance Test (PGCET) 2022 for MTech, ME, and MArch courses on 19th November 2022.

While for MBA and MCA courses, the Post Graduate Common Entrance Test (PGCET) 2022 was conducted on 20th November 2022. The question paper had Multiple Choice Questions (MCQs) worth 100 marks for each paper. The question paper was available in English, and there was no negative marking. All the aspirants got 2 hours (120 minutes) to solve the question paper.

After releasing the Karnataka PGCET Results 2022, the Karnataka Examinations Authority (KEA) will start the document verification procedure for the aspirants who have cleared the written examination. The document verification will start on 3rd January 2022 from 02:00 PM to 04:00 PM. The documentation procedure will be organized in Mysore, Kalburgi, Mangalore, Dharwad, Bangalore, Belagavi, Devangere, Shimoga, and Bijapur. The last date for the documentation procedure is on 13th January 2022.

KEA Merit List 2022

The merit list for the Karnataka Post Graduate Common Entrance Test (PGCET) 2022 will be released along with the KEA PGCET Results 2022. All the names of the applicants who would clear the written examination will be mentioned rank-wise on the merit list. Aspirants can download the merit list PDF from the official KEA webpage.

The online portal for the KEA PGCET Registration 2022 was opened on 15th October 2022. The registration fee for General category aspirants was INR 650, and for other Reserved categories like SC, ST, OBC, etc., the fee was INR 500. The deadline for registration was 29th October 2022. The application correction process started on 31st October 2022 and ended on 2nd November 2022. Check the official notification for more details like eligibility criteria, etc.

Karnataka PGCET Cut off Marks 2022

The Karnataka Examinations Authority (KEA) will upload the PGCET Cut-off Marks 2022 with or after releasing the KEA PGCET Results 2022. Since the result will be announced on 29th December 2022, we can expect the cut-off marks to be released in the month of January 2022. The Karnataka Examinations Authority (KEA) will prepare the cut-off marks based on the difficulty level of the examination, the total number of available seats, previous years’ cut-off marks, and the total number of participating aspirants.

The cut-off marks are the minimum qualifying marks of any examination that every applicant has to gain to qualify for the examination. KEA PGCET Results Check 2022

  • First, open the official Karnataka Examinations Authority (KEA) webpage, i.e., cetonline.karnataka.gov.in, on your device.
  • Afterwards, go to the ‘Latest Announcements’ section on the homepage.
  • Then, find and press the link regarding the KEA PGCET Results 2022.
  • Next, login into the webpage using your Registration Number or CET Number and press the Submit button.
  • After that, your report card will appear on your device.
  • Next, thoroughly verify your report card and then click on the Download button to save the report card.
  • Lastly, print out a coloured hard copy of your report card for further proceedings.
